Drapion - is this thing workable?

Drapion #452



Abilities
Battle Armor: Negate critical hits.
Sniper: Critical hits deal 4x damage.

Stats
HP 70
Atk 90
Def 110
Spd 95
SpA 60
SpD 75

So it's somewhat quick (faster than Heracross!) and has good defense, but meh everything else. Its stats total to 500, which is hardly bad, although 60 of them are sunk into its worthless SpA.

Acupressure looks interesting, but when it has both Swords Dance and Agility I'm not sure why you would need it. Knock Off is a cool move, and it's one of the few Pokemon to get Poison Spikes.

Weaknesses and Resistances
x2 Ground
x.5 Grass, Poison, Ghost, Dark
x0 Psychic

So, it trades a weakness to a common physical type for a boatload of resistances to uncommon types.

Sets

Poison Spiker
Drapion @ Toxic Sludge
Impish (+Def, -SpA) 176 HP / 156 Def / 176 Spd
-Poison Spikes
-Knock Off
-Poison Stab/Cross Poison
-Whirlwind

Shamelessly stolen from ADH, this set outspeeds Adamant Heracross and Knocks Off its Choice Band, allowing it to be more manageable to Poison Spikes teams. Poison Jab has 10 more base power than Cross Poison, but Cross Poison has a high critical hit ratio, which could be helpful with Sniper.

CBer
Drapion @ Choice Band
-Night Slash
-Earthquake
-Aerial Ace
-Pursuit
Whee, Choice Band! We've all seen it before, folks. STAB Night Slash can hurt things, especially with a Sniper Critical Hit (33%!) Aerial Ace has the disadvantage of being a crappy move, but the advantage of hitting pretty much everything SE that both Night Slash and EQ hit NVE. It also OHKOes Heracross and Breloom. Unfortunately, 90/95 attack/speed aren't really enough to do it. Drapion fills the niche of a quick CBer who can take physical hits, but it's a pretty small niche to fill.

An SD set would also be possible, but it isn't really worthwhile, as 90 attack/95 speed really isn't good enough to do something like that.

Aerial Ace over Poison Stab on the Poison Spiker. If you outspeed Heracross, why not just kill it? Okay, it's impossible for it to have a guarenteed OHKO, but even from min Atk, Aerial Ace is a 2HKO. If you're knocking off CB, why not just kill it? Knock Off is still just useful, so that's why I choose to remove Poison Stab.
 
It's a shame that with it's extremely good defensive typing and moves, it's defensive stats aren't that great. I like the toxic spiker set-- knock off is cool when offensive pokemon rely so much on choice band/specs and defensive ones rely on lefties.

It might not make OU because there are too many pokemon that can simply sweep it with nuetral attacks or have EQ.
 
Aerial Ace leaves you with no STAB move at all. Drapion's sole job isn't to kill Heracross, Knock Offing it is just a bonus.
 
Seeing as how its the only decently good toxic spiker, I'll expect him to be used as that (or maybe Tentacruel?).
Knock off and Taunt really help out too.

A point about the defense, its amazing. With only one obvious weakness (EQ) he can take at least two physical hits from pretty much anything and has enough speed to outrun and knock off. And should you feel the EQ, it's just too easy to pass off to a flier or levitator (and he's done his job with the spikes).
 
For the first set, I'd rely on a Stealth Rocker for Roar/Whirlwind and replace that move with Aerial Ace. That's what my Drapion will have. Toxic Spikes should lure Heracross in for the kill.
